COMMUNITY NEWS

  • Lee County Sheriff deputies were honored for rescuing a Beauregard teen from an October fire, with Sheriff Jay Jones noting they always look for a chance to serve others.  Opelika-Auburn News

GOVERNMENT NEWS

  • Opelika Police Chief Shane Healey — a respected leader with 35 years of service — will retire on March 1, 2026, and his retirement celebration is scheduled for Feb. 20, 2026 at the Opelika Public Library.  The Observer
